I might get fired soon after I start work. If it's World of Warcraft (as opposed to Warcraft II or III), it's only online and there's only one version. It's also a monthly fee (or buying 60-day game cards at the store). The game comes with one month free. If it's Warcraft I, II and/or III, those are strategy games while WoW is a massively-multiplayer role playing game (like Everquest, but with better graphics). The Warcraft games can be online (player vs. player) or offline (you vs. computer).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
